Meaning
Advanced wound care and dressings refer to a range of medical products and technologies designed to promote wound healing, reduce infection risk, and improve patient comfort and quality of life. These products include hydrocolloids, hydrogels, foam dressings, alginate dressings, collagen dressings, antimicrobial dressings, and negative pressure wound therapy systems, among others. Advanced wound care products are used in the treatment of chronic wounds, such as diabetic ulcers, pressure ulcers, venous ulcers, and surgical wounds, as well as acute wounds and traumatic injuries.

Category-wise Insights
- Hydrocolloid Dressings: Used for managing lightly to moderately exuding wounds, hydrocolloid dressings create a moist wound environment conducive to healing while providing a protective barrier against external contaminants, promoting autolytic debridement and granulation tissue formation.
- Foam Dressings: Highly absorbent and conformable, foam dressings are indicated for managing moderate to heavily exuding wounds, providing cushioning, protection, and moisture control while maintaining a moist wound environment conducive to healing.

Market Key Trends
- Biodegradable Dressings: Increasing interest in biodegradable wound dressings made from natural or synthetic polymers, such as chitosan, alginate, and polylactic acid (PLA), for sustainable wound management solutions with reduced environmental impact and improved patient outcomes.
- Smart Dressings: Integration of smart sensors, wireless connectivity, and real-time monitoring capabilities into wound dressings enables continuous assessment of wound status, fluid management, and infection detection, facilitating early intervention and personalized wound care interventions.
